Here in Prior Lake, Minnesota, we have a vibrant and growing nursing job market that reflects our community's dynamic healthcare landscape. Nestled along the beautiful shores of Prior Lake and surrounded by stunning natural parks, this city offers both picturesque views and a supportive environment for healthcare professionals. According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, the median annual wage for registered nurses in Minnesota is approximately $79,990, translating to about $38.46 per hour, while the national median stands at $80,010 annually, or $38.46 hourly. In Prior Lake, we estimate that the average salary range for nurses is between $75,000 and $85,000 annually, influenced by the increasing demand for healthcare services in our region. With nearby cities like Burnsville and Shakopee, which also have robust healthcare sectors, our nursing job market enjoys a competitive edge in salary offerings and opportunities.

The nursing job market in Prior Lake is characterized by steady growth and a strong demand for professionals. Our community needs an estimated 150 new nurses over the next three to five years, partly due to an aging population and the continual expansion of healthcare services in the area. Based on recent estimates, we have approximately 800 nurses currently working in the city, and the demand for travel nurses and per diem positions has shown promising growth, particularly during the summer months when patient volumes surge at our local healthcare facilities. Major employers in the region include the Fairview Health Services network, which operates a community hospital nearby, along with various clinics and specialty centers catering to our diverse population. In comparison, Burnsville and Shakopee have similar healthcare facilities, but the lifestyle and community offerings in Prior Lake—with its array of recreational activities and strong local culture—set us apart from our neighbors, creating unique opportunities for nurses to thrive.
In terms of healthcare infrastructure, Prior Lake is home to several key facilities, including the Fairview Clinic and numerous specialty outpatient centers that cater to various healthcare needs, from pediatrics to geriatrics. There are ongoing investments in developing more advanced healthcare facilities to meet the rising demands of our community, with future projections suggesting that our population will grow by approximately 4% over the next five years, adding more opportunities for nursing roles.
